MFC扩展库BCGControlBar Pro v34.1 - 支持Windows 10/11字体图标

BCGControlBar库拥有500多个经过全面设计、测试和充分记录的MFC扩展类。 我们的组件可以轻松地集成到您的应用程序中,并为您节省数百个开发和调试时间。

BCGControlBar专业版 v34.1已正式发布了,这个版本包含了对Windows 10/11字体图标的支持、功能区和可视化设计器增强等功能,最新版点击下方获取:

BCGControlBar Pro for MFC v34.1正式版下载

在v34.1中新增了一个类:CBCGPWebView2View,封装了CBCGPWebView2Ctrl。该类为在文档/视图应用程序中使用CBCGPWebView2Ctrl提供了一种简单而有效的方法,它的接口与CHtmlView非常相似,在将代码升级到WebView2时最大限度地减少了大量工作的需要。

在新版本中实现了对Windows 10/11字体图标的支持,最新的Windows版本(10和11)提供了一套丰富的内置字体图标(可以在Windows 10的Segoe MDL2 Assets和Windows 11的Segoe Fluent Icons字体中找到)。在这个版本中,BCGControlBar库实现了一种简单有效的方法来在应用程序中使用这些图标。首先您可以使用Ribbon Designer来添加这些字体图标,并在几次点击中自定义它们的外观。或者您可以在新方法CBCGPSVGImage::CreateIconFromFont的帮助下创建字体图标,然后使用这个SVG图标,或者使用CBCGPToolBarImages::AddSVGIconFromFont新方法将字体图标添加到图像列表中。

BCGControlBar v34.1新版图集

注意:BCGSoft不收集、保存或分发这些图标,也不对其外观和内容负责,您只能在运行Windows 10或11的客户端机器上使用这些图标。

Ribbon Bar

1. 新版本中已经实现了在暗黑主题中指定Ribbon图标外观的功能:

  • CBCGPRibbonBar中的一个新方法,SetImagesLuminosityInDarkThemes,允许您指定Ribbon图标的亮度和暗黑主题中库图标的外观。
  • CBCGPRibbonBar::SetImagesLuminosity现在包括一个可选参数 - galleryIconsLook,它可以接受的值,如'original', 'default', 'inverted',或'simplified'。
  • 如果CBCGPRibbonBar方法SetImagesLuminosity和SetImagesLuminosityInDarkThemes的参数dblRatio被设置为0,Ribbon图标将被简化。

BCGControlBar v34.1新版图集

2. 新方法CBCGPRibbonBar::IsTouchMode指示Ribbon栏触摸模式当前是否被激活。

3. Ribbon Designer改进:

  • Ribbon Designer现在支持字体图标,允许从“Segoe Fluent Icons”字体(适用于Windows 11)或“Segoe MDL2 Assets”字体(适用于Windows 10)轻松分配图标到Ribbon控件。

BCGControlBar v34.1新版图集

  • 新属性 'Images Luminosity' 和 'Gallery Icons Look' 被添加到Ribbon Bar。
  • 为状态栏引入了一个新的 'Icons Style'属性。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/597036.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

微信聊天记录恢复只需简单3招,快速找回聊天内容!

各种社交软件早已深深融入我们的日常生活,无论是与亲朋好友的闲聊,还是与同事伙伴的工作沟通,都离不开它们的陪伴。然而,有时由于误操作、系统更新或手机故障等原因,我们可能会不小心删除了重要的聊天记录,…

【JavaWeb】Day36.MySQL概述——数据库设计-DDL(三)

查询 关于表结构的查询操作,工作中一般都是直接基于图形化界面操作。 1.查询当前数据库所有表 2.查看指定表结构 3.查询指定表的建表语句 注意:23版的点击导航中的转到DDL 修改 关于表结构的修改操作,一般也是直接基于图形化界面操作。 添…

力扣1047. 删除字符串中的所有相邻重复项

思路:消消乐的感觉,就先想到栈;用一个栈存放遍历过的元素,和遍历中的下一个元素相比,相同则出栈,不同则入栈,最终栈内剩余的就是不相同的元素。 class Solution {public String removeDuplicat…

同一局域网内,如何ping通另一台电脑

有两条电脑,一台是我的,一台是我室友的。 使用手机的热点。 两台电脑同时连接我的手机的热点。 通过ipconfig查看信息: 我的电脑: IPv4 地址 . . . . . . . . . . . . : 192.168.92.79 子网掩码 . . . . . . . . . . . . …

WPS二次开发系列:WPS SDK实现文档打印功能

在办公场景或者家教场景中经常碰到需要对文档进行打印的能力,今天给大家带来一篇如何通过WPS SDK调用WPS打印接口实现文档打印能力 最终实现效果图 实现步骤 2.1. 申请集成资料 通过向WPS官方发送邮件申请,审批通过后即可获取集成相关资料,详…

为什么PCA(Principal Component Analysis)中的协方差矩阵只能衡量变量之间的线性相关性,而不能衡量非线性关系?

PCA(Principal Component Analysis,主成分分析)是一种广泛应用于数据分析和机器学习的技术,主要用于数据降维和特征提取。在PCA中,协方差矩阵起着核心作用,它描述了数据集中不同特征(变量&#…

买什么样的护眼落地灯比较好?五款优质护眼大路灯推荐

作为一名电器研究员,我对大路灯这类的照明工具非常熟悉,身边的朋友也经常会向我咨询买什么样的护眼落地灯比较好?使用优质的的大路灯能缓解平时不良光线带来的疲劳和酸痛,但最近很多人说用了入手了一下品质不佳的大路灯,导致出现眼睛干涩、酸痛等现象。所…

Spring AI 来了,打造Java生态大模型应用开发新框架!

Spring AI 来了,打造Java生态大模型应用开发新框架! Spring AI 开发框架设计理念Spring AI 主要功能特性如下 Spring AI 应用开发案例案例一:基于大模型的对话应用开发案例二:RAG 检索增强应用开发案例三:Function Cal…

带刻度透明PFA量筒耐强酸碱耐高温全氟烷氧基树脂量具

PFA量筒为上下等粗的直筒状,特氟龙量杯是上大下小的圆台形,底座均有宽台设计,保证稳定性,两者均可在实验室中作为定量量取液体的量具,上沿一侧有弧嘴设计,便于流畅地倾倒液体。 规格参考:5ml、…

Python爬虫-爬取药膳食谱数据

🎈 博主:一只程序猿子 🎈 博客主页:一只程序猿子 博客主页 🎈 个人介绍:爱好(bushi)编程! 🎈 创作不易:喜欢的话麻烦您点个👍和⭐! 🎈…

【论文阅读笔记】SAM-Adapter: Adapting Segment Anything in Underperformed Scenes

1.论文介绍 SAM-Adapter: Adapting Segment Anything in Underperformed Scenes SAM适配器:在表现不佳的场景中适配任何片段 2023年 ICCV Paper Code SAM Fails to Segment Anything? – SAM-Adapter: Adapting SAM in Underperformed Scenes: Camouflage, Shado…

怎么在UE过场动画中加入振动效果

我们已经学会了怎么在游戏中加入振动效果,比较典型的交互场景如:在开枪时让手柄同步振动,实现起来真的很简单,就是定义场景和事件,然后在游戏事件发生时播放特定的振动资源文件,跟播放音效是极其相似的&…